Criteria A
Explains and justifies the need for a solution to a problem
for a client/ target audience:-
The problem faced by many civil engineers are that they
mastered with the techniques of laying a good foundation for
the house but are unable to execute exactly what the
customer’s demand for the INTERIOR of the house are. As
a result of this many individual house owners or even multi
story building owners are now not satisfied with the way the
interior of their house is constructed. Some of them are built
in a way that the rooms have insufficient space or some have
too much empty space that is unwanted by tenants.
Recently, my uncle has taken up a project to build a house
for himself and has approached me to make a plan for all the
rooms in the house. He does not want improper planning in
the availability of space in the rooms and wants them to be
sufficient enough and a good looking architecture.
Therefore, I have decided to make a 3D design where it will
include all the details concerning the interior that will need
to be kept in mind while constructing. A digital design of the
room plans could be of a better use than normally doing
with pencil and paper which usually engineers find difficult
to work out. Problem:-Unplanned Rooms in a house. My
client is My Uncle and my target audiences are the civil
engineers who are looking for a 3D designing of the interior
fundamentals of a house. Solution: Make a 3D design of the
rooms.
